Delphi皮肤组件库
Link Rank Software 的 VCLSkin 与 DotNetSkin 是面向传统 Windows 桌面开发的换肤组件。VCLSkin 服务于 Delphi/C++Builder 的 VCL 应用,DotNetSkin 服务于 .NET WinForms。其核心卖点是把组件放到主窗体后,即可让整个应用的窗体与控件获得皮肤效果,官方强调无需修改源代码。
从功能覆盖看,VCLSkin 支持 Delphi 标准控件、窗体标题栏、MDI 窗体、公共对话框、消息框、嵌入窗体、Dockable forms、DLL 窗体,以及同一应用内两种样式等场景。控件层面覆盖按钮、菜单、工具栏、Tab/PageControl、进度条、状态栏、ComboBox、Memo、ListView、TreeView、Grid 等。第三方生态是其亮点,页面列出 Raize、ExpressQuantumGrid、LMD tools、TMS、Toolbar2000、TNT Unicode、QuickReport、Virtual TreeView、Billenium Effect 等支持。DotNetSkin 则覆盖 WinForms 的 SDI/MDI、菜单、工具栏、按钮、复选框、ComboBox、Statusbar、TabControl、ListView、DataGrid 等。
站点提供 Free Try、Buy Now、Purchase/Order 入口,可判断为商业组件并支持试用,但抓取文本没有价格、授权人数、升级策略、退款或付款方式。文档方面,页面列出大量功能点、截图、下载、Skin Builder 和示例入口,但更接近老式产品说明页,缺少现代化 API 参考、安装教程、兼容矩阵和问题排查内容。
优点是接入门槛低,对 Delphi/VCL 老项目尤其友好,且皮肤文件资源较多:VCLSkin 提到 70 多个内置皮肤并可获得更多皮肤,DotNetSkin 有 66 个皮肤文件。缺点也明显:更新记录偏旧,DotNetSkin 最新释放日期显示为 2008 年,VCLSkin 虽列出 XE6 支持但没有更新到现代 Delphi、.NET 或 Windows 版本的信息;开源状态、源码授权、自托管、服务支持均未说明。
它适合仍在维护 Delphi/C++Builder VCL 或 .NET WinForms 旧桌面软件、希望快速统一界面风格的团队。若是新项目,需谨慎评估维护状态和兼容性。中国访问、支付可用性在文本中没有证据,建议购买前先试用下载、确认邮件支持和授权交付方式;若访问或付款受限,可考虑同类 VCL/WinForms 商业 UI 控件或使用框架原生主题方案替代。
本测评基于公开资料整理,不构成购买建议,请以 link-rank.com 官网实际信息为准。
老牌VCLSkin组件,适合Delphi桌面开发。
评分明细(分布与用户短评)接入中。当前展示 TG4G 综合评分,数据源自公开测评与用户反馈。